Please meet Meteor – a full-stack JS framework that was designed for building real-time web and mobile applications. Full-stack – means that it works on a front-end and back-end at the same time. Real-time – means that it takes care of the whole development process – from the application’s creating to a deployment. This framework was built on the top of a popular cross-platform JavaScript runtime environment called – Node.js. We will talk about it later.
Meteor has been built using concepts from the other frameworks and libraries. It makes web development easier by letting you to prototype applications in very balanced and simple way. It’s flexible and requires less code, which means that you will have less bugs and more stable end result. If you have already used it, you’d know what I mean.
If you are not sure about the technology stack for your future project, you should take a closer look on it. Meteor is “easy to learn and quick to build”, this fact makes it really popular in the developers’ community. This framework saves you project delivery time and your budgets too.
